Corned Beef and Cabbage Casserole Recipe
- 1 small cabbage
- 2 tablespoons butter or margarine
- 1/2 cup chopped onion
- 1 (12 ounces) can corned beef
- 3 tablespoons butter or margarine
- 3 tablespoons flour
- 1 1/2 cups milk
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/8 teaspoon pepper
- 2 tablespoons butter or margarine
- 1 cup fine bread crumbs
Cut cabbage in half and each half into 3 pieces. Remove core and boil in salted water for 20 minutes. Drain and put in the bottom of a 1 1/2-quart casserole dish.
Melt 2 tablespoons butter in a frying pan. Add onion and corned beef and saute. Break up corned beef and continue sauteing until onion is clear. Pour mixture over cabbage.
Melt 3 tablespoons butter in a medium saucepan. Stir in flour, then add milk and salt, and pepper and bring to a boil while stirring. Pour over meat mixture.
Melt 2 tablespoons butter in a small saucepan. Stir in crumbs to blend and sprinkle over top of sauce.
Bake uncovered at 250 degrees F for 30 minutes.
